HomeMobileAndroid10 Best Nintendo 3DS & NDS Emulator for Android

10 Best Nintendo 3DS & NDS Emulator for Android

Anyone who has used any Nintendo 3DS or GameBoy Advance ever will remember that exciting gaming experience that current consoles might overrun but can’t rejoice you. Google Play Store has an armament of apps across various categories and that includes gaming emulators as well. I am talking explicitly about Nintendo 3DS Emulator for Android. Well, we have curated a list of best Android 3DS emulators that you love to use.

Here is the list of the best Nintendo 3DS Emulator for Android that we have found after extensive research and after trying these emulators as well.

DraStic DS Emulator

DraStic DS Emulator

Apparently, the best Nintendo 3DS emulator for Android, DraStic DS Emulator has one of the most smooth graphics that I found on any emulator. In fact, the app upscales it to twice on a phone with quad-core chipsets. Instead of cramping two screens on Nintendo 3DS devices, this emulator has six display modes that users can check out and play. This ensures that everything is stable and the graphics are at the top-notch compared to other emulators.

I tried for a while and found out users can attach controllers and even physical controllers with it. There is a colossal cheat code available with it that users can enter and get an edge over their competitors.

The emulator is overall optimized to save battery and takes backups of all the data so that you never lose your game’s progress and can continue where you left. It has a feature called ‘Fast Forward’ which bypasses any long conversations before or after any game in case if you don’t want to go through it.

Most reliable performance
Add-on controllers
Access to cheat codes
Superior graphics

Doesn’t performs well with all DS games
No multiplayer mode
No Wi-Fi emulation support
There is no demo available

Price: $4.80 | Download from PlayStore: DraStic DS Emulator


RetroArchRetroArch is basically a powerful emulator that can run multiple systems including PlayStation SNES, Nintendo DS, and others. It is equipped with location support, cross-platform camera support, OpenGL and has a tonne of features that are either already available are will be added to it.

It does act as a program to create or play games and more. RetroArch receives constant updates and has options to enter cheats, multi-language support, etc. RetroArch 3DS Emulator works a bit different since you need to download all the games that you actually want to play on the emulator.

The best thing is that it is open-source and doesn’t have any ads that would annoy anyone. But the grass isn’t all green because there are some backlogs. The app is a bit complicated to use compared to the alternatives available while the bugs kick in at time although not all times.

Supports multiple systems
Free from any advertisements
Multi-language support
Save States & take screenshots

A bit complicated than others
Minor bugs here and there

Price: Free | Download from PlayStore: RetroArch

12 Solutions to Boost Nintendo Switch Battery Life


nds4droidThis is a particularly new emulator for Nintendo 3DS. It is a reliable emulator on Android smartphones and has a considerable consistent update although it does have its own share of bugs and a few instability issues here and there. The NDS4droid app is an open-source program and can play almost any ROMs you want to check out. It is also plugged in with a bunch of features that make it one of the Best Nintendo 3DS emulators although not the only the best.

You can save game stats allowing players to simply get back to the point where they left without going through each level again. Note that the developers have themselves acknowledged the fact that the emulator isn’t full-fledged. Search for a 3DS Android emulator on Google Play Store and you would find it for sure.

Supports .nds, .rar, .zip, & .7z
Save States in SD Card
It is based on DeSmuME
Doesn’t have fast-forward option
A few performance issues
Slow even on newer devices

Price: Free | Download from PlayStore: nds4Droid

12 Best Vehicle Simulator Games for Android & iPhone

Citra 3DS Emulator for Android

Citra 3DS Emulator for AndroidNoted as one of the best Android 3DS emulators, Citra 3DS Emulator is not officially released yet. This means that you will have to stick to an unofficial APK version. Anyways, the emulator is considered the best on the Android platform and has plenty of features on-board. It jacks up the resolution and since it is open-source, it can be easily installed and you can add more features, games, ROMs as well.

The app itself is based on Dolphin Emulator which means it will be a great choice for old school gamers for sure. The app has one of the best settings and configuration controls all within the GUI. Simply install the app, load the Nintendo 3DS ROM and you are good to go.

Citra 3DS runs many of the 3DS games impeccably although there might be a bit of glitch and bugs here and there since it isn’t yet an official stable version. Furthermore, the gameplay might be a little slow at well.

Plays games at a higher resolution
It is open-source
Easy to tweak controls via GUI
Not official yet for Android
May induce gameplay & lag
Local Wifi but won’t connect to servers

Price: Free | Download from XDA: Citra 3DS Emulator for Android

Pretendo NDS Emulator

Pretendo DS EmulatorLive that nostalgic Nintendo 3DS gaming experience again on your Android phone or tablet with Pretendo NDS Emulator. It stands as one of the top ten Android 3DS emulators if you search the web and that is why I have listed it here after trying it out personally. The app is pretty easy to install and works flawlessly as it supports multiple formats include .zip, .rom, .ds, .rar, etc. You can simply load any ROM to it and bang, the app will let you experience the old school gaming on your phone.

The app itself has features like self-guard which actively saves the progress of your game state so that you can simply load where you left. It also has features like precision controls in areas with lower resolution. You can also boost the emulation speed by disabling graphics and sounds with a dedicated option to it as well.

The app is fit for everyone who wants to play games from Nintendo 3DS or other supported systems. But it is also plagued with ads that are constantly popping up on the screen and ruining the gaming experience. This is basically its biggest flaw but if you really have a look at it, you can actually let go of this ‘con’ for all the ‘pros’ listed.

It supports multiple ROMs format
Self-guard to save games automatically
Heavily customizable controls

The app is plagued with advertisements
It is no longer available on Play Store
Instability issues

Price: Free, Contains Ads | Download from PlayStore: Pretendo NDS Emulator

12 Top Racing Games for Android in 2019

NDS Boy!

NDS Boy!Play Final Fantasy to Super Mario Bros to Pokemon sage all NDS Boy, the best Android 3DS emulator compatible with any games that run on hand-held Nintendo 3DS gaming console. The emulator itself is packed with a plethora of features such as support to various file formats that include .zip, .rar, .7z, and .nds, etc.

The emulator further has high RAM requirements since lower RAM would slow it down a bit. It also comes equipped with additional configuration options along with auto-save and load game states, custom controls, etc.

Adjust screen orientation, size, and buttons on the display as per your requirements and you are good to go. The app is free of charge and has ads placed on it allow a premium version is available which will help get rid of any ads whatsoever.

Save, auto-save, & load game states
Screen orientation & customizable screen size


Occasionally crashes & may lag
Bloated with ads
Requires RAM above 2GB and quad-core CPU or higher

Price: Free, Contains Ads | Download from PlayStore: NDS Boy!

NDS Emulator

Except for the ads part which is annoying and sometimes there are three ads back-to-back, the NDS Emulator is worth trying out. It works on devices with Android 6.0+ and supports .nds and .zip files and caters to a wide range of audiences thanks to its support to a large variety of games. It can also edit screen layouts and controls can be modified as well. Next up, players can connect the phone running on NDS Emulator with external controllers as well.

It is one of the best 3DS Android Emulator according to me also you will have to bear the ads-part as I mentioned above. The NDS Emulator is also equipped with saving and loading game states that allow users to simply jump into the action without waiting or playing through the levels to reach the point where you actually left. It also accepts cheat codes that will give a tough competition to the rival but some cheats might not work and show an error message around it.

Works on Android 6.0+ and above
Editable controls and screen layout
Save game states, load them directly
Support .nds, .zip

Plagued with ads
Error with certain cheat codes

Price: Free, Contains Ads | Download from PlayStore: NDS Emulator

8 Best Fortnite Gaming Controllers for iPhone and Android

Ultimate x3DSx Gold

Ultimate x3DSx GoldI bought it intriguing just with the name of this emulator which doesn’t appear good but it is. The Ultimate x3DSx Gold is literally the ultimate 3DS Android Emulator one can have as it can run almost all the games you have on Gameboy Advance and Nintendo 3DS. It has a bunch of sensors that are used in its faster emulation which in terms lowers the power consumption. It supports both external and wireless controllers.

You can use or disable cheat codes while playing any Nintendo 3DS game on this emulator as well. It has a fast-forward feature and has OpenGL in the backend that takes away the excessive stress on the GPU itself. Finally, the app has a clean user interface which is something not all emulators have so I praise it for that.

Supports External Controllers
Runs all the games from GBA & 3DS
Gyro/tilt/soar/rumble emulation
Faster emulation, less power consumption

Slow & bloated with tonnes of ads
Accepts & runs only legally bought games

Price: Free, Contains Ads | Download from PlayStore: Ultimate x3DSx Gold


EmuBoxThe latest addition to the bunch, EmuBox supports multiple systems including Nintendo DS, PlayStation SNES, and others. It is also the first emulator to get multiple-system support with Material Design that offers it an impeccable look and feel. This Android 3DS emulator surely knows how to pull off the plugs on its rivals with fast forward support, save and load game states at up to 20 slots per compatible ROM.

The emulator is free to use although it does have ads that keep it running. But there could be a Pro version too although we don’t know anything about it at this moment. EmuBox comes with many pros and cons similar to any other 3DS emulator for Android which includes bugs when the player uses too many cheat codes.

The app itself is similar to DraStic although not as good. It does lack configurable controls which is a bit of a bummer but once you get the hang of it, this is one of the best emulators you would have.

Suggests multiple ROMs
First emulator with Material Design
Supports Fast Forward
Save/Load game states up to 20 slots

Bugs when using cheat codes
Slow at times in transition
Lack of configurable controls

Price: Free, Contains Ads| Download from PlayStore: EmuBox


AseDSAseDS is basically another 3DS Android emulator that you should try if you aren’t yet settled for any of the above-mentioned emulators. The app isn’t available on Play Store but I have posted the like to download it below so don’t worry about it.

The emulator has plenty of features such as it lets users keep the actual size of the screen as per the resolution the game is to stretch it out. The users have options to go into portrait and landscape orientation without any hassle. Note that the emulator does have a tendency to crash at times showing you a white or other screen but it does have support to almost all Nintendo 3DS games and runs it pretty swiftly so you can ignore the rest.

The next thing you should know is that it doesn’t have a fast forward button but has frame skipping with flicker reduction so that you can skip the boring part. The app also has saved and load game state that makes the gaming experience much more friendly.

Faster game speed
Supports multiple file formats
Auto-portrait and landscape orientation
Supports microphone & external controllers

There is no fast forward button
Crashes Occasionally
Ads are often annoying

Price: Free, Ads Ads | Download from PlayStore: AseDS

10 Best Android Emulators for PC and Mac

Choosing Nintendo 3DS Emulator for Android might not be as easy as it sounds. Every emulator listed here has a different trait, feature, capabilities, and backlogs or shortcomings which is what sets it apart from other emulators.

At the end of the day, you cannot expect to get the same experience while playing on an emulator than on an actual Nintendo 3DS console which means choosing any of these apps might never give you that pleasure.

But these emulators are made for those who want to try out old school consoles on their Android smartphones due a number of reasons such as they don’t want to spend on an actual console or they aren’t able to do so, etc where most of the people would stick to buying ‘Pro’ version of an emulator to escape buying a console worth $300 more or less.

I personally like DraStic DS Emulator, Ultimate x3DSx Gold, NDS4Droid but you need to try a few of them because deciding on latching onto one for all your gaming sessions.

Disclosure: Mashtips is supported by its audience. As an Amazon Associate I earn from qualifying purchases.


  1. What is this list? Only Citra is a 3DS emulator! What are you talking about?
    Drastic (a FAMOUS DS-only emulator) labeled a 3DS emulator? Retroarch?? Since when?
    Is this an AD in the shape of an article?

    • Yep when i saw drastic being a 3ds emulator i stopped believing the article then went on to read many more like retroarch you said before


Please enter your comment!
Please enter your name here

You May Like

More From Author